Survey Spot Review — We Put This Survey Site to the Test

Important Update for 2019: After publishing this SurveySpot review, the site closed down on June 30, 2019, and you will no longer be able to take surveys. However, its sister sites Opinion Outpost, and Opinion World continue to operate. We will keep an eye out on the situation, and in case it changes, advise you of any pertinent updates.

Survey Spot Reviews – About This Site

Survey Spot is a market research and paid survey platform launched in 2000. The market research company Dynata owns it. This global digital data collection and online sampling company provides market research data and insights to its clients

Members of Survey Spot get to take surveys and participate in sweepstakes on the platform and are rewarded for their time and effort. They may also take part in the occasional sweepstake for a chance to win prizes.

On joining the platform, members will automatically receive an entry into the massive $10,000 quarterly sweepstakes draw.

The platform is famed for its fast processing times. Payment is via PayPal and usually fulfilled within two days. If you opt for physical gift cards, expect to receive them at your home address within ten business days.

Only residents of the US over the age of 18 are eligible to participate.

How Does Survey Spot Work?

You’ll need to register on the Survey Spot site and create an account to become a member. You'll be required to provide your name, address, date of birth, gender, education level, and a valid email address.

When filling in this information, and creating your Survey Profile, it is essential to do so accurately. Should your answers differ in the surveys taken later, you risk being disqualified from the study, as there will be apparent discrepancies.

On joining the site, you will be automatically entered into the quarterly draw, where you stand a chance of winning up to $10,000.

Most surveys will earn you 50 – 100 points, depending on their length and complexity. Every 100 points equate to $1, and you’ll need a minimum of 50 points to cash out Amazon gift cards, or 1,000 points to cash out via PayPal. You will get further entries to the quarterly sweepstake after completing each survey.

This platform also offers an instant win play. This game allows you to play an online slot machine or scratch card game with a chance to win more prizes.

Once you reach the withdrawal threshold, you can opt to receive your rewards via PayPal within 48 hours. You may also opt to receive Amazon or iTunes gift cards, sweepstake entries, or even air miles! Gift cards should reach you within ten business days.

SurveySpot Reviews – Is This Site Legit?

Survey Spot is, from all our investigations in this Survey Spot review, a legit company. They have a long track record of paying their members and have honored gift cards and vouchers in conjunction with their partners.

Their parent company Dynata sports a positive A- rating on the Better Business Bureau, but they do sport a below-average score of 40% on Survey Police from 376 customer reviews.

It’s not hard to find a negative SurveySpot review online, mostly focusing on issues such as lack of customer care response, inadequate communication on the timing of surveys, and some delays in receiving already redeemed rewards.

To get a flavor of what people think on the platform, check out these recent comments from users on trusted review sites and forums online.

“I have been a member of Survey Spot for many years. It was easily my favorite site. Within the last year, I maybe received one survey. I sent them an email, and they responded just to wait, and something would come. It is not that I do not qualify; it is that they don't send me any anymore.”– Phyllis (USA) on Survey Police. February 3, 2019.

“I've been a member for over ten years, and they used to be great. For the past two years, they've gone downhill fast. They pay next to nothing for surveys now. 20-minute surveys might get you 25 cents. That's if you qualify, which takes a long time. 500 points for $5 will take a long time to reach now. They are no longer one of the best.” – Pam T. on Get Paid Surveys. May 5, 2016.

Survey Spot – The Good, the Bad, and the Ugly

Pros

  • The surveys posted on this site don’t require much effort and can be completed relatively quickly. If you have some spare time and enjoy taking surveys online, Survey Spot is a decent site to choose for work, as you can soon accumulate points in your account.
  • The site also offers both rewards and sweepstakes. These are yet more opportunities to make money on the site.
  • The cash out threshold is low, which is a positive point for us in this SurveySpot review. You’ll need a minimum of 500 points ($5) to cash out for Amazon gift vouchers. You may also choose to accumulate 1,000 points and cash out $10 via PayPal.
  • The varieties of surveys available are an added advantage on this site. This feature keeps the site engaging and unique and makes the survey availability very high.
  • Payment processing is quite efficient. PayPal payments are processed within two days, and gift vouchers will be shipped to your address with within ten working days.
  • Points earned on the site are redeemable at some of the top retail outfits in America. Use your points for Amazon and iTunes gift vouchers, sweepstake entries, PayPal Cash, or even airline miles.

Cons

  • Their surveys can be misleading, especially in regards to the time expected to complete them. You may sign up for a 10-minute survey, and find yourself still filling it in 20 minutes later. This occurrence can be frustrating, and frankly annoying.
  • We’ve noticed as we’ve looked into this SurveySpot review, that users do not like the lack of response from the customer service department. They don't respond to customer queries and concerns in a timely fashion if they do get back at all.
  • They have a limited global reach. The panel is only open to residents of the United States.

Final Thoughts

Survey Spot is a legitimate site. All our investigations in this Survey Spot review point to that fact. This site compensates its members for their opinions. Note, however, that you will not make much, on average about $1 per survey.

If you’re thinking of joining the platform, the compensation is reasonable, and will probably be enough to pay those bills or supplement your shopping budget.
